Exports In 2022, Jordan exported $1.14M in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ids, making it the 65th largest exporter of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ids in the world. At the same year,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ids was the 324th most exported product in Jordan. The main destination of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ids exports from Jordan are: Syria ($983k), Morocco ($80k), Egypt ($68.5k), United Arab Emirates ($2.28k), and Australia ($1.13k).
The fastest growing export markets for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ids of Jordan between 2021 and 2022 were Syria ($668k), Morocco ($80k), and Egypt ($68.5k).
Imports In 2022, Jordan imported $21.4M in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ids, becoming the 63rd largest importer of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ids in the world. At the same year,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ids was the 237th most imported product in Jordan. Jordan imports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ids primarily from: China ($5.37M), Saudi Arabia ($5.11M), United Arab Emirates ($2.53M), South Korea ($1.75M), and India ($1.39M).
The fastest growing import markets in Saturated Acyclic Monocarboxylic Acids for Jordan between 2021 and 2022 were China ($2.61M), Saudi Arabia ($1.12M), and Netherlands ($442k).
